Foundation Skills
Bibliothèque de skills IA pour les équipes Dedalus ERP-PAS. Chaque skill donne des instructions à votre assistant IA (Copilot, Claude Code, Cursor, Windsurf) pour accomplir des tâches de manière fiable et reproductible.
Installation
# Installer tous les skills
npx skills add Dedalus-ERP-PAS/foundation-skills -g -y
# Mettre à jour
npx skills add Dedalus-ERP-PAS/foundation-skills -g -y --update
Prérequis : Node.js 18+ et npm.
Guide complet : docs/comment-utiliser.md
graph LR
A[Développeur] -->|Installe les skills| B[CLI skills]
B -->|Copie dans le projet| C[Répertoire .skills/]
C -->|Chargement dynamique| D[Agent IA]
D -->|Exécute les instructions| E[Tâche réalisée]
Skills disponibles
Code et architecture
| Skill |
Description |
Doc |
| coding-standards |
Conventions de nommage, principes SOLID, TypeScript/JavaScript |
doc |
| backend-patterns |
Architecture backend : API RESTful, repository pattern, DB, caching |
doc |
| react-best-practices |
Best practices React/Next.js, shadcn/ui, React 19+ |
doc |
| vue-best-practices |
Best practices Vue.js 3/Nuxt, Composition API, PrimeVue |
doc |
| typescript-migration |
Migration incrémentale JavaScript vers TypeScript |
doc |
Design system et UI
| Skill |
Description |
Doc |
| design-compliance |
Audit de conformité au design system Hexagone avec auto-correction |
doc |
| business-compliance |
Audit de conformité aux règles métier (docs/domain/) — report-only, santé |
doc |
Tests et qualité
| Skill |
Description |
Doc |
| tdd |
Développement piloté par les tests (red-green-refactor) |
doc |
| testing-patterns |
Patterns de test : unitaire, intégration, E2E, mocking |
doc |
| security-review |
Audit de sécurité et OWASP Top 10 |
doc |
| git-guardrails |
Bloque les commandes git dangereuses (push --force, reset --hard) |
doc |
Revue et gestion de projet
| Skill |
Description |
Doc |
| code-review |
Revue de code des merge requests GitLab |
doc |
| issue-review |
Revue autonome d'issues par personas IA |
doc |
| triage-issue |
Investigation de bugs et création d'issues |
doc |
| gitlab-issue |
Gestion des issues GitLab |
doc |
| github-issues |
Gestion des issues GitHub |
doc |
| changelog-generator |
Changelogs automatiques depuis l'historique git |
doc |
Collaboration
| Skill |
Description |
Doc |
| meeting |
Réunion simulée avec personas experts |
doc |
| fast-meeting |
Réunion autonome rapide avec décision et MR/PR |
doc |
| meeting-report |
Compte-rendu automatique en français depuis une transcription Teams (.vtt) — spécifique hexagone-monorepo |
doc |
| grill-me |
Interview approfondie pour valider un plan |
doc |
| ubiquitous-language |
Extraction de glossaire DDD (domaine santé) |
doc |
Documents
| Skill |
Description |
Doc |
| docx |
Documents Word (.docx) |
doc |
| xlsx |
Fichiers Excel (.xlsx) |
doc |
| pptx |
Présentations PowerPoint (.pptx) |
doc |
| pdf |
Fichiers PDF |
doc |
| article-extractor |
Extraction d'articles web |
doc |
| docs |
Génération de README et documentation |
doc |
Hexagone et domaine santé
| Skill |
Description |
Doc |
| hexagone-frontend |
Composants frontend Hexagone (@his/hexa-components) |
doc |
| hexagone-swdoc |
Web services Hexagone (endpoints, contrats) |
doc |
| hexagone-web-feature-extractor |
Exploration d'un espace Hexagone Web en document PO |
doc |
| hpk-parser |
Parsing des messages HPK propriétaires |
doc |
| hl7-pam-parser |
Parsing des messages HL7 v2.5 IHE PAM |
doc |
| uniface-procscript |
Référence ProcScript pour Uniface 9.7 |
doc |
Outils
| Skill |
Description |
Doc |
| playwright-skill |
Automatisation navigateur et tests web |
doc |
| postgres |
Requêtes SQL lecture seule sur PostgreSQL |
doc |
| mcp-builder |
Création de serveurs MCP |
doc |
| setup |
Installation des outils CLI, auth GitHub/GitLab, config Jira MCP |
doc |
| write-a-skill |
Guide pour créer un nouveau skill |
doc |
Ressources
Licence
MIT